The Security Watchdog specialises in providing support services to the manned guarding industry, including on-site audit programmes, contract monitoring, operational due diligence, recruitment and screening.
The Watchdog was established back in 1998 as an on-site auditory body for the manned security industry in order to raise standards of on-site performance. Since those early days the organisation has developed a membership of 91 manned guarding companies (many of whom have advanced to Gold Award level), a growing consortium of end users and Associate Membership categories.

By means of independent on-site audit, Watchdog managing director Terry O'Neil and his team of auditors have been able to identify those aspects of on-site performance requiring improvement and, in report format, have passed on this information to the senior management of the contract company to the benefit of the contract as a whole.

The audits themselves focus on individual officer performance, site and local management support, screening records and training history, random on-site patrols, assignment documentation and client satisfaction levels. Up-to-date industry statistics have been collated as a result of the nationwide audit programmes.

The Security Watchdog's Screening Bureau, established in 2000, handles a growing requirement from Watchdog member companies who want to outsource their screening requirements to BS 7858. The Bureau now offers a significant number of bespoke screening packages outside of the industry. The Bureau is an umbrella body of the Criminal Records Bureau, and is inspected to BS 7858 by the National Security Inspectorate. Terry O'Neil also sits on the British Standards Committee reviewing BS 7858.

The Watchdog is further developing four strands of business in addition to its core membership services: recruitment (Dome Security Requirement), screening (The Screening Bureau), training (by way of the Training Forum) and the aforementioned Control Centre for smaller contractors.
